Studies have shown that solar electric propulsion has a wide range of mission applications and offers attractive payload capability compared to all-chemical systems. A key element of solar electric propulsion is the solar array. Multikilowatt solar arrays have been under development for several years, during which time a number of component developments have been undertaken for the purpose of reducing mass and proving feasibility. This paper summarizes the technical accomplishments that demonstrate the feasibility and readiness of large-area, lowmass solar arrays for electric propulsion missions.
